  • FirePro V5900 has 87% more power consumption, than Quadro P600.
  • FirePro V5900 is connected by PCIe 2.0 x16, and Quadro P600 uses PCIe 3.0 x16 interface.
  • FirePro V5900 and Quadro P600 have maximum RAM of 2 GB.
  • Both cards are used in Desktops.
  • FirePro V5900 is build with TeraScale 3 architecture, and Quadro P600 - with Pascal.
  • Core clock speed of Quadro P600 is 830 MHz higher, than FirePro V5900.
  • FirePro V5900 is manufactured by 40 nm process technology, and Quadro P600 - by 14 nm process technology.
  • FirePro V5900 is 85 mm longer, than Quadro P600.
  • Memory clock speed of Quadro P600 is 3012 MHz higher, than FirePro V5900.
